MIDDLEBURY, Vt. – Bill Waldron, professor of religion, and collaborators from the University of California-Davis and the Mangalam Research Center for Buddhist Languages, have received a grant from the John Templeton Foundation to support a project titled Putting the Buddhism/Science Dialogue on a New Footing.

The grant provides funding for a 10-day ‘brain-storming conference’ in Berkeley, CA, this summer with 20 leading neuroscientists, clinicians, philosophers and Buddhist scholars, and will take a ‘transdisciplinarity’ approach to the scientific study of meditation.
